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00068 | $0.00433 |
| Opus 5 | $0.00034 | $0.00217 |
| Sonnet 5 | $0.00014 | $0.00087 |
| Haiku 4.5 | $0.00007 | $0.00043 |
Grade A, and why
brain-to-docs sc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 11d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.
What it actually says
brain-to-docs
The whole purpose: extract as much of the user's taste, judgment, knowledge, vision,
preferences, and decisions as possible into text — saved as clear, concise
markdown docs for the project. README holds the vision; docs/adr/ holds the
decisions.
The loop
- Check docs first, every time. Read
docs/adr/(andREADME.md) before doing anything — other agents and people add/edit ADRs constantly. - Ask 5 different questions in plain text (never a questions UI) — default 5 unless the user asks for a different number. Make them high-variety: a wide, creative spectrum of unique angles, not all the same type (e.g. not all "tech stack" or all "product" or all "monetization"). Exception: if the user asks for a specific focus area, follow it. The user answers whichever he finds most useful.
- Update docs after EVERY answer — no exceptions. You decide whether it
updates
README.mdor becomes a new ADR — whatever makes sense. - Repeat until the user says "we're done" (or similar).
Rules
- All answers & responses during this "brain to docs" process must be VERY CONCISE, all sentences should be SHORT, and everything should be written in PLAIN ENGLISH.
- ADRs: short, numbered
NNNN-slug.md, Status + Context + Decision + Consequences. - README: vision only. Decisions go in ADRs.
- Don't challenge the user's thinking unless the user asks, or the user is making a severe mistake.
